Wellness support for cancer caregivers in Istanbul

Kolon Kanseri

Part of Cancer, Mental health clinical trials.

This study tests a psychoeducation program based on positive psychotherapy to help caregivers of cancer patients. It may improve your well-being and caregiving experience.

Who can take part

  • You are 18 years or older
  • You are a caregiver for a cancer patient
  • You scored 90 or below on the Barthel Index (a measure of daily living activities)
  • You have at least a primary school education
  • You have no current or past psychiatric diagnosis
  • You have no vision or hearing problems that make communication hard
  • You live in Istanbul
